What these ratings do and do not tell you

The overall rating folds together inspections, staffing and quality measures. Inspections carry the most weight.

Staffing hours are the number to read on your own. A five-rated home with thin registered nurse cover is a different place at three in the morning.

Visit before you decide. Go without an appointment. The record here tells you where to look, not what you will find.
